How to Choose the Right 9000 BTU Mini Split
Consider Room Size
- Square Footage: A 9000 BTU unit is effective for spaces up to 400 square feet. Measure your room to ensure it falls within this range.
- Ceiling Height: Higher ceilings may require additional cooling capacity. Consider a model with a higher BTU rating if your ceilings exceed 8 feet.
Assess Energy Efficiency
- SEER Rating: Look for a unit with a high SEER rating (above 20 is ideal) for optimal energy savings.
- Energy Star Certification: Units with this certification meet strict energy efficiency guidelines.
Evaluate Features
- Wi-Fi Capability: Allows for remote control via smartphone apps, enhancing convenience and flexibility.
- Multiple Modes: Choose units with cooling, heating, dehumidifying, and fan modes for versatile functionality.
- Noise Levels: Check the dBA rating to ensure it meets your noise tolerance levels.
Installation Considerations
- Professional vs. DIY: While some units are designed for DIY installation, hiring a professional can ensure proper setup and compliance with local codes.
- Location of Units: Consider the placement of both the indoor and outdoor units for optimal performance and minimal noise.
User Tips for 9000 BTU Mini Split Air Conditioners
- Regular Maintenance: Clean the filters monthly and schedule professional maintenance annually to ensure efficiency and longevity.
- Optimal Settings: Utilize the ‘Eco’ or ‘Sleep’ modes when appropriate to save energy during off-peak hours.
- Temperature Control: Set the thermostat to a comfortable temperature and avoid frequent adjustments to maintain efficiency.
- Smart Controls: Take advantage of Wi-Fi features to program cooling schedules, ensuring your space is comfortable upon arrival.

FAQ
What is a mini split air conditioner?
A mini split air conditioner is a type of HVAC system that consists of an indoor unit and an outdoor compressor. It provides cooling and heating without the need for ductwork.
How does a 9000 BTU mini split work?
It works by transferring heat from indoors to outdoors (for cooling) or vice versa (for heating) using refrigerant. The compressor adjusts based on the temperature set by the user.
Is a 9000 BTU mini split suitable for my room?
It is suitable for rooms up to approximately 400 square feet. Measure your space to ensure it falls within this range for optimal performance.
What is the difference between SEER and EER?
SEER (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io) measures efficiency over an entire cooling season, while EER (Energy Efficiency Ratio) measures efficiency at a specific temperature (95°F).
How noisy are mini split air conditioners?
Noise levels vary by model but generally range from 25 to 45 dBA for indoor units, making them quiet enough for use in bedrooms and offices.
Do I need professional installation?
While some units are designed for DIY installation, professional installation is recommended for optimal performance and compliance with local regulations.
Can I control my mini split with my smartphone?
Many modern mini splits offer Wi-Fi capability, allowing you to control them remotely via smartphone apps.
How often should I clean the filters?
It is recommended to clean the filters every month to maintain optimal airflow and efficiency.
What maintenance does a mini split require?
Regular maintenance includes cleaning filters, checking refrigerant levels, and scheduling annual professional inspections.
Can I use a 9000 BTU mini split in winter?
Yes, many mini splits function as heat pumps, providing efficient heating even in cold weather. Check the unit’s specifications for its heating capabilities.
